After "save changes and exit" in the BIOS, the mobo acts as if its going to restart and apply the changes but then it just hangs. I have to power down by either 10 seconds on the power button or unplug to shutdown and cold restart, and THEN it boots.
It hasn't done this from the start though. I am on BIOS version 2.40. It seemed to start after I was configuring the RyZen core disable settings and toggling SMT. Could that have triggered it? How should I solve this? By either resetting bios settings to default, or go as far as to reflash by BIOS?
